The Ultimate Buying Guide: Dress Shoes for Heavier Gentlemen
Finding the right dress shoes when you carry extra weight is important. Good shoes give you comfort and support all day. Poorly made shoes can hurt your feet and wear out fast. This guide will help you pick the best dress shoes for your needs.
Key Features to Look For
Heavy individuals need shoes built for extra stress. Look for these main features:
- Wide Toe Box: Your toes need room to spread out. A narrow shoe squeezes your feet, causing pain. Look for shoes labeled “Wide (E)” or “Extra Wide (EE).”
- Strong Arch Support: Extra weight puts more pressure on your arches. Good arch support prevents foot fatigue and pain in your legs and back.
- Durable Outsole: The bottom of the shoe must be tough. Thick, sturdy rubber or dense leather soles last much longer under heavy load.
- Padded Collar and Tongue: These soft parts around the ankle and top of the foot prevent rubbing and blisters, especially important when walking long distances.
Important Materials for Longevity
The materials used directly affect how long your shoes last and how comfortable they feel.
Upper Materials:
- Full-Grain Leather: This is the best choice. It is strong, molds to your foot over time, and breathes well. It resists scuffs better than cheaper options.
- High-Quality Synthetic Leather: Some modern synthetics are quite durable, but ensure they are specifically marketed for heavy use, as cheaper versions tear easily.
Sole Materials:
- Rubber (Dainite or Commando Style): These offer excellent grip and absorb shock very well. They handle wet conditions better than leather.
- Thick Leather Soles: While classic, ensure the leather is very dense. These look formal but need resoling sooner if you walk a lot.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Quality shows in how the shoe is put together. These construction details matter greatly for heavier wearers.
Construction That Adds Quality:
- Goodyear Welt Construction: This is the gold standard. A strip of leather (the welt) is stitched to the upper and insole. This makes the shoe very strong and allows a cobbler to easily replace the sole when it wears out. This significantly extends the shoe’s life.
- Reinforced Shank: The shank is a stiff piece hidden in the middle of the sole that supports your arch. For heavier guys, this shank must be made of strong steel or dense composite material, not weak plastic.
What Reduces Quality (Avoid These):
- Cemented Construction: The sole is simply glued to the upper. This construction is cheap and light, but it separates quickly under heavy stress.
- Thin or Foamy Soles: These compress rapidly, offering no long-term support. They quickly lose their cushioning.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about where you will wear these shoes most often.
Office Professionals:
If you sit most of the day but still need a sharp look, a classic leather Oxford or Derby shoe with a Goodyear welt is perfect. Focus on comfort features like padded insoles.
People on Their Feet All Day:
If you walk a lot, prioritize shock absorption. Choose shoes with rubber outsoles and excellent arch support. A Derby style often offers more room around the instep than a tight Oxford.
Remember, investing a little more in quality construction now saves you money and pain later. A well-made shoe supports your body correctly.
10 FAQs About Dress Shoes for Heavy Guys
Q: What is the most important feature I must check?
A: The most important feature is the width and the support structure, especially the arch and shank. You need stability.
Q: Should I buy leather or rubber soles?
A: For maximum durability and grip, rubber soles are often better for heavy use. Leather soles look dressier but wear down faster.
Q: How often should I replace my dress shoes?
A: If you wear them daily, even high-quality shoes might need sole replacement every 1-2 years. Inspect the sole and heel often.
Q: What does “Goodyear Welt” mean for me?
A: It means the shoe is built to last. A cobbler can easily separate and replace the worn-out sole without damaging the rest of the shoe.
Q: Are pointed-toe shoes a bad idea?
A: Yes, pointed toes usually mean a narrow toe box. Always choose a round or square toe shape for maximum room.
Q: Do I need special socks?
A: Yes, wear moisture-wicking socks made of wool or technical blends. They reduce friction and keep feet dry, preventing blisters inside your sturdy shoes.
Q: Can I wear casual sneakers as dress shoes?
A: No. Sneakers lack the necessary rigid support needed for the extra weight and do not look professional in formal settings.
Q: How do I clean heavy-duty leather shoes?
A: Clean dirt off, apply quality leather conditioner to keep the leather supple, and then polish them. Conditioning prevents cracking under stress.
Q: Are slip-on shoes safe for heavy use?
A: Slip-ons can sometimes slip off your heel, causing instability. Lace-up shoes allow you to customize the fit tightly across your midfoot, which is safer.
Q: Where should the extra support come from—the shoe or an insole?
A: The shoe should provide the primary structure (shank and sole). You can add an aftermarket orthotic or supportive insole for personalized comfort on top of that structure.
